Songs of Phantasia

"Songs of Phantasia" is a tribute to the music of Tales of Phantasia. Fantastic game with an amazing soundtrack that unfortunately don't get love often by VGM Cover artists, except "Fighting of the Spirit", of course. A similar situation with that of Super Castlevania IV with Theme of Simon while ignoring all the other great tunes.
Tales of Phantasia is also in my TOP of all-time favorite videogames and the soundtrack has (in my opinion) some of the best stuff Sakuraba ever composed. Full of variety, catchy melodies and extremely tricky stuff when it comes to arranging and playing.
So it was a matter of time this project becomes a reality. 11 covers, arrangements, remixes or whatever, of 11 different songs. A wide variety of styles and moods but mostly with metal as a base. Featuring a big bunch of talented artists all around the world.
All tracks arranged, produced, mixed and whatever by Unknown Pseudoartist at Ancient Computer Studios (except track 7, mixed by minusworld).
Original source tracks composed by Motoi Sakuraba, Shinji Tamura, Ryota Furuya except track 1 (Toshiyuki Sekiguchi).
